Shubhani Meaning — Origin, Gender & Details (2025)

Shubhani is a beautiful and meaningful name of Sanskrit origin, predominantly used for girls in Hindu communities. It carries the profound significance of ‘auspiciousness’ and ‘good fortune,’ making it a popular choice for parents seeking a name that embodies positivity and blessings. This name reflects deep cultural roots in Indian traditions, where auspiciousness is a cherished value in daily life and ceremonies. Meaning of Shubhani

Shubhani derives from the Sanskrit word ‘śubha’ (शुभ), which fundamentally means ‘auspicious,’ ‘fortunate,’ ‘blessed,’ or ‘conducive to success.’ The suffix ‘-ani’ is a feminine formative in Sanskrit, often used to create nouns indicating possession or relation, similar to ‘-ani’ in names like ‘Kiran’ or ‘Tara.’ Thus, Shubhani translates to ‘the auspicious one’ or ‘one associated with good luck.’ In Hindu philosophy, ‘śubha’ is a key concept linked to purity, prosperity, and divine favor, frequently invoked in rituals, astrology, and naming conventions. Linguistically, it shares roots with other Sanskrit names like Shubha and Shubhangi, emphasizing themes of positivity. This meaning is well-documented in Sanskrit dictionaries and etymological studies, confirming its accuracy across historical and modern usage.

Origin & Cultural Significance

Shubhani originates from Sanskrit, an ancient Indo-Aryan language that is the liturgical language of Hinduism and has influenced many South Asian languages. It is deeply rooted in Hindu culture, where names are often chosen based on their meanings to invoke blessings and positive qualities for the child. The name is prevalent in India, Nepal, and among Hindu diaspora communities worldwide, reflecting the enduring importance of auspiciousness in Hindu traditions. While primarily Hindu, the name’s Sanskrit roots mean it can be appreciated across cultures, though it is not commonly used in other religious contexts like Islam or Christianity. Its usage dates back centuries, with variations appearing in classical texts and modern times, symbolizing a timeless connection to cultural heritage.
